The Siberian Husky was the breed of dog, that on February 2, 1925, was responsible for the method of transportation of a precious serum that cured many during a diphtheria outbreak in Nome, Alaska. Known as one of the oldest dog breeds, the Collie had a very regal start. In the early 1860s, Queen Victoria brought a Scottish Sheepdog from the highlands in Scotland back to England. Every American Wirehair cat can be traced back to one cat, Adam, who was born in 1966 on a farm in Vernon, New York, to Bootie and Fluffy who were normal haired. Ragdoll the Docile The Ragdoll is one of the newest cat breeds, starting in the early 1960s. The urban legend is one that tells of an American named Ann Baker, who owned a Persian cat named Josephine.
